Arketype Receives Inaugural Mosaic Award And 8 Gold Addys In 2007
Ad Competition


GREEN BAY, WI, March 3, 2008 — The Fox River Ad Club awarded its first-ever Mosaic Award to the advertising and design firm, Arketype, Inc., in recognition of advertising efforts that promote diversity and issues related to multiculturalism. The inaugural honor came on the heels of Arketype's winning eight Gold ADDY® Awards and 14 Silver ADDY® Awards during Friday night's 2007 American Advertising Federation awards ceremony, held at The Ravine, Green Bay.

"This Mosaic Award validates the remarkable power of our collective design community," said Jim Rivett, Arketype president. "Graphic design has the unique ability to enlighten and empower our communities, and designers have ample opportunities to help area nonprofit organizations in exceptional ways."

Included among Arketype's Gold ADDY® award-winning client projects was a video produced for the Museum of Contemporary Art in Chicago to promote its 40th anniversary gala, which also netted a Best of Show nomination. Additionally, Arketype received a Gold ADDY® and a Judges' Choice nomination for its "Happy World" campaign, created for the firm's annual Martin Luther King, Jr. Day community event.

Other Gold ADDY® awards were given for the firm's work for the following clients:

  • The CiveFest '07 poster illustration for Chives Restaurant
  • The logo creation for Burst
  • The corporate identification package for Attach, LLC
  • The thinkmarriage.org campaign for Foundation for a Great Marriage

Silver awards presented to Arketype recognized a host of print and multimedia work for a variety of its clients including Kimberly-Clark, Integrys Energy Services, Baileigh Industrial, and the John Michael Kohler Art Center.

The district ceremony is the first of a three-tiered national competition conducted annually by the American Advertising Federation. Arketype's gold-winning projects will advance to a four-state regional competition, with the opportunity to again advance to the national level.

With nearly 60,000 entries from across the country, the ADDYs are the industry's largest and most represented competition for creative excellence.
